The value of x from the given diagram is 17
<h2>Vertically opposite angles</h2>
From the given diagram, m<2 and m<3 are vertically opposite since they form angles from the intersection of lines at the point X
Given that;
- m<2 = 4x + 2
- m<3 = 5x - 15
Equate both expressions to have:
m<2 = m<3
4x + 2 = 5x - 15
4x - 5x = -15 - 2
-x = -17
x = 17
Hence the value of x from the given diagram is 17.
